The Mechanism of Anabolic Steroids on Protein Synthesis

Anabolic steroids primarily affect protein synthesis through several key mechanisms:

  1. Increased Nitrogen Retention: Anabolic steroids promote a positive nitrogen balance, which is essential for muscle growth. This means the body retains more nitrogen than it expels, creating an optimal environment for protein synthesis.
  2. Enhanced Protein Synthesis Rate: These steroids boost the rate at which proteins are synthesized in muscle cells. This leads to faster muscle recovery and growth post-exercise.
  3. Inhibition of Protein Breakdown: Anabolic steroids help reduce the rate of protein degradation. This anabolism allows muscles to preserve more of the proteins they produce, contributing to overall muscle mass.

Risks and Considerations

Despite the advantages, the use of anabolic steroids is not without risks. Potential side effects can include hormonal imbalances, liver damage, and cardiovascular issues. Therefore, it is crucial to approach their use with caution and under medical supervision.
